Alright, let’s just get this post out of the way.

– The episode kicks off with Valkyria conjuring up a ball of antimatter to annihilate one entire side of a small hill. That’s right! Antimatter is literally a glowy, purple ball of energy that in no way resembles matter at all!

– Elsewhere, the cops are trying to clean up Valkyria’s handiwork, but they’re too distracted by the burning hill. Just look at that awesome censoring though. If we’re going to censor everything that can potentially traumatize us, I’m not sure why Brynhildr‘s badness is being ignored.

– Somehow, one of the previously dead witches manages to stitch her severed body back together. Damn, that’s pretty powerful! We find out later that she can even survive her head being crushed. But yes, she’ll still die if she doesn’t take her meds every once in a while. That’s just stupid.

– Our heroes hear about the explosion on the internet. They instantly suspect that Valkyria is behind it. When they talk about her, however, it sounds like they’re talking about some kind of goddamn Pokemon.

– The next day, Kogoro calls Ryota into his office to tell him all about why the witches melt when they don’t take their medicine. It’s the build up of protease, you see. Using a former colleague’s research, however, Kogoro will be able to fashion a pill in a month’s time. And that colleague’s name?! Ichijiku! Wow, we’ve come full circle!

– Speaking of Ichijiku, we see a scene between him and Valkyria. We learn her real name, but it doesn’t really matter what it is. She tries to intimidate him, but he flatout slaps her across the face. And this… this somehow tames her. It makes perfect sense now! Ryota and Ichijiku are just two sides of the same coin. Except, y’know, our protagonist has been pilfering from Ichijiku’s collection.

– Ryota tells his girls the bad news, so Kazumi proposes thatintend to draw lots to see who gets to survive. Pfft, as if Kuroha would allow that. She thus removes herself from the lottery, setting in motion a domino effect wherein no one wants to become a part of the lottery. In the meantime, Stitchy leaves the room because she too doesn’t feel that she deserves to be a part of the lottery process. In reality, she has a bunch of pills on her, and she’s just holding out on everyone. She tested Ryota’s loyalty, but who’s going to test hers?!
